The isomorphism problem for all hyperbolic groups

Abstract

We give a solution to Dehn's isomorphism problem for the class of all hyperbolic groups, possibly with torsion. We also prove a relative version for groups with peripheral structures. As a corollary, we give a uniform solution to Whitehead's problem asking whether two tuples of elements of a hyperbolic group GG are in the same orbit under the action of \Aut(G)\Aut(G). We also get an algorithm computing a generating set of the group of automorphisms of a hyperbolic group preserving a peripheral structure.
